Carys is a young, single mom adjusting to life with a baby. An injury caused her to retire early forcing her to reevaluate the future. I was devastated for her, seeing her dreams just disappear as she was getting to her peak. For someone so young, Carys has had to endure a lot. Her ex leaves her pregnant and her mother is not very supportive. She’s had to go at it alone, but that doesn’t stop her from being the best mom out there. I really do admire her strength and tenacity. Her heart is definitely in the right place. She pushes on no matter what life throws at her. Carys wants what is best for Sunny and she will go to all extremes for it. She knows what she wants in life and goes for it, head on.
Deacon’s the manwhore next door keeping Carys awake at night with his evening activities. As awkward as it is, she finally gets the balls to broach the subject. That talk leads to their unusual friendship. Who says men and women can’t be friends? Deacon is such a sweetheart, his patience with Carys and her daughter. He will bring Carys random coffees and will pick up some things at the store for her, even put some special gifts in there. Their friendship flows so easy and natural, it’s like they’ve known each other for years. The banter between the two is cute and hilarious, no topic is off limits. Deacon proves himself to be the baby whisperer when he can get Sunny to stop crying. Talk about ovaries bursting when Deacon is all about the baby. I absolutely love the fact that their friendship has evolved over a great period of time.
Both Deacon and Carys have pasts that cause them both to put up walls. Their friendship is all they can give one another. As hard as they try, their connection and undeniable attraction make it very hard for them to remain platonic. Walls slowly start to fall and they easily transition from friends to something more. We watch their friendship grow and their lives interweave. Just watching Deacon fall in love with Sunny will melt your heart. It takes a strong man to care deeply for another man’s child and he does it flawlessly. We go on the journey with Carys and Deacon as they go through their ups and downs. And boy what a journey it is. Their relationship has definitely not been an easy one. Your heart will drop for a second, as mine did, but will slowly piece back together. When you hit a rough patch and your past comes back to the forefront, everything you have worked towards can all come crashing down. I found myself rooting for both Carys and Deacon till the very end, wanting them both to overcome the obstacles thrown at them. But maybe they were doomed from the beginning?
